Analysis
Sri Lanka recorded 50.14 % change on previous year for fibreboard — import quantity, annual growth rate in 2024.
That represents a change of down 16.3% on the previous year and down 21.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, fibreboard — import quantity, annual growth rate in Sri Lanka peaked at 410.61 % change on previous year in 2001 and was at its lowest, -70.61 % change on previous year, in 2007.
Sri Lanka ranks 29th of 204 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
The year-on-year percentage change in Fibreboard — Import quantity.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
Computed from
- Fibreboard — Import quantity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
